the rev counter is driven off the alternator and erratic readings mean, normally, either the alternator is iffy or a loose connection. note that the alternators (I think) have an earth strap to the engine block.

That's the usual scenario Austin, but here's another for you. My rev counter has been acting up for a couple of days and it turns out the water pump is leaking slightly from the seal and occasionally water gets on to the pulley and/or belt as the engine warms up from cold and it only leaks for a short while and then when you stop to look, it's OK. Only sussed it when it started leaking a bit more and was noticeable. (200 Tdi)
